About Banjo Irwin
Banjo Irwin, Kelpie cross a young 16 months, medium size (knee high) weighing approx 20kg
He is a beautifully natural boy.
He loves the company of people and is great with other dogs once introduced.
Currently in a foster home living with a family that has 2 children ages 8 and 11 as well as 2 big dogs, male 6yo and female 14 months. Does not show food aggression and is gentle when accepting his food.
Responding brilliantly with training and his basic commands of sit, stay, waiting for food on the leash and his recall off lead is constantly improving while enjoying the dog park.
Very intelligent dog who thrives on learning new things and would benefit from a confident family who will continue with his further training.
He is house trained while showing good manners inside. Loves going for walks, runs and rides in the car.
Fabulous with children, very tolerant and is a very smoochy boy it's lots of love to give.
He would be suitable for a family, if he is given a lot of attention and if left for long periods on his own, he would need the company of another dog if this was the case.
Previously has jumped farm fencing, so a secure fenced area is required.
Has shown a dislike to cats
Currently in care in Hurstbridge, Victoria
